The Rise of Alpharetta as a Tech Hub

Alpharetta’s transformation into a technology hub can be attributed to several factors. Firstly, its proximity to Atlanta provides access to a larger talent pool and a vibrant business community. Additionally, the city has invested in infrastructure, creating an attractive environment for tech companies. The local government has also implemented initiatives to support entrepreneurship and innovation.

Strategic Location

Located just north of Atlanta, Alpharetta is well-positioned for businesses looking to tap into the resources of a major metropolitan area while enjoying the benefits of a smaller community. The city is easily accessible via major highways, making it convenient for businesses and employees alike.

Government Support

The Alpharetta government actively supports the tech sector through various programs and incentives designed to attract new businesses and encourage innovation. This includes tax incentives, grants for startups, and support for local entrepreneurship initiatives.

Key Players in Alpharetta’s Technology Ecosystem

Alpharetta is home to a diverse range of technology companies, from startups to established enterprises. Some of the prominent players in the local tech scene include:

Data Centers and Cloud Services

Alpharetta is known for its robust data center infrastructure, with several major companies operating facilities in the area. These data centers provide essential services for cloud computing, data storage, and cybersecurity.

Software Development and IT Services

Many software development firms and IT service providers have established their operations in Alpharetta. These companies offer a wide range of services, including custom software development, IT consulting, and system integration, catering to various industries.

Fintech and E-Commerce

Alpharetta has also become a hotspot for fintech and e-commerce companies. The city’s favorable business climate and access to capital have attracted several startups in these sectors, providing innovative solutions for financial services and online retail.
